  2. Water depth is just a display option if I remember right. Are we going to start on the new version, or the current one? I see you already generated a map, but I'm not sure if it'll carry over to the next release if that's what you're planning. Also it might be worth just uploading the entire folder somewhere, to prevent any discrepancies between player files. A suggestion for player order would be to have an experienced player start for year one, then alternate between less experienced and more experienced players. This would probably give us more room for mistakes without the fort falling apart entirely, and gives us a pretty decent timeline. Year 1 is like setup and general self-sufficiency, year 2 is mostly crafts and exploration, year 3 might be a military setup and expansion, year 4 could be a bit more exploration and expansion, and year 5 might get magma. There's no hard rules or guidelines for that kind of thing, so it's really anyone's guess, but keeping newer players separated can prevent a progression drought.
